i965: Apply depthstencil alignment workaround when doing fast clears.
Fast depth clears have the same depth/stencil alignment requirements as other drawing operations. Therefore, we need to call brw_workaround_depthstencil_alignment() from both the clear and drawing paths. Without this fix, we get image corruption if the following conditions hold: (a) the first ever drawing operation to a depth miplevel (or the first drawing operation after having used the texture for sampling) is a clear, (b) the depth miplevel has a size that is eligible for fast depth clears, and (c) the depth miplevel has an offset within the miptree that isn't 8x8 aligned. Fixes piglit "depthstencil-render-miplevels" tests with size 273.
